#8d643c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8d643c is composed of 55.3% red, 39.2%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.1% magenta, 57.4%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 29.6 degrees, a saturation of 40.3% and a lightness of 39.4%. #8d643c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c878 with #1b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#8d643c color description : Dark moderate orange.
#8d643c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8d643c has RGB values of R:141, G:100,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.57,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9266236.
